14.8: X-Ray and Gamma-Ray of the Milky Way Galaxy

Two high-energy emission spherical bubbles, X-ray and gamma-ray in nature, were detected north and south of the Milky Way Galaxy’s core in 2010 by the Fermi Gamma-ray Space Telescope. It is estimated that the diameter of each bubble is about 25,000 light years.
